Models > 580321470 > Parts

580321470 Craftsman Engine - Parts

Jump to:

97 - 108 of 114
Keep searches simple, eg. "belt" or "pump".
Fan
$11.70
Special Order
No Longer Available
Special Order
Special Order
Special Order
$33.90
Special Order
Special Order
Special Order
Special Order
In Stock
Order now and your part arrives by Mar 19
Special Order
Special Order
97 - 108 of 114